RAL 070 40 10 Mink brown vs RAL 080 30 26 Smoked oak brown
Side-by-side comparison of RAL 070 40 10 and RAL 080 30 26. Click on a color to view its full details page.
Color Comparison
With a Delta E of 11.6,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Orange hue family. RAL 070 40 10 has a neutral temperature while RAL 080 30 26 has a warm temperature. Both colors have similar brightness with LRV values of 10.8 and 6.0. RAL 080 30 26 is more saturated (45%) than RAL 070 40 10 (12%).
